Cold Soba Noodles

Cold Soba Noodles

In Japan, cooked buckwheat noodles are often served with a soy-based dipping sauce; here the sauce is combined with the noodles for a flavorful and easy dish.

Serves 4

Prep Time 10 min

Total Time 10 min.

Nutrition Profile: Gluten Free Diet   Healthy Weight   Heart Healthy   Low Calorie   Low Cholesterol   Low Sat Fat  

Ingredients

  • 8 ounces soba noodles
  • 2 scallions, sliced
  • 2 teaspoons sesame oil
  • 2 teaspoons reduced-sodium soy sauce
  • 2 teaspoons toasted sesame seeds

Cooking Directions

Step 1


Cook noodles according to package directions. Drain the noodles in a colander and rinse under cold running water until cool. Transfer to a medium bowl and toss with scallions, oil, soy sauce and sesame seeds.
